How to use the Quickie Ball Gag?
- Inspect the toy and give it a gentle pull to understand the stretch range.
- Guide the silicone strap behind your or your partner’s head, positioning the ball at the center of their mouth.
- Have the wearer gently bite down on the ball while you stretch the strap into place behind the head or neck.
- Check comfort and safety: Make sure breathing is unobstructed and that the gag can be removed easily if needed.

How to clean and care for the Quickie Ball Gag?
- Cleaning: Wash with warm water and mild soap or a body-safe toy cleaner immediately after each use.
- Drying: Pat dry with a clean towel and leave it out to fully air dry before storing.
- Lubricant compatibility: Avoid using lube with this toy—none is needed for its function and excess slickness can reduce grip.
- Storage: Keep in a breathable fabric pouch or drawer, away from other silicone toys to maintain material longevity.

Special considerations when using Quickie Ball Gag:
- Mobility requirements: User or partner must be able to stretch and position the strap behind the head.
- Dexterity: Easy to use but still requires basic coordination to fit properly.
- Breathing: Always monitor that the gag wearer can breathe properly through the nose before and during use.
- Speech limitations: This toy limits verbal communication—pre-establish safewords or signals (like tapping) before play.
